We are excited to share that the Burning Man European Leadership Summit (ELS) is coming to Nijmegen! From 16 to 19 April 2026, we’ll welcome community builders, artists, event organizers, and changemakers from around the world to our hometown! As you may know, the values of 50/50 Fest are rooted in the principles of Burning Man, making this a very good match.

Since 2014, the ELS has been a unique gathering where dreamers, doers, and organizers come together to share knowledge, spark ideas, and build lasting connections. In 2026, the theme is “The Art of Becoming”  focusing on transformation, creativity, and the reimagining of society.

Together with Burning Man and Burning Man NL, we invite you to help co-create this special event of connection and imagination.

How joining the ELS works
The ELS is a gathering for community leaders from regional Burning Man communities. You do not sign up directly. Participation starts with a nomination.
Nominations come from Regional Contacts or through self-nomination. They show that someone is active in their local community and ready to contribute on a wider level.
After the nomination comes the application for participation.
Applications are reviewed to keep the event balanced and focused on leadership.
Only approved applicants receive a registration link.

Contribute your art, ideas, and experiments
Besides attending by nomination, you can also participate by bringing something of your own. Art. Workshops. Installations. Experiments. Social moments. Something that teaches, moves, or surprises. The Call for Interactivity is open now.

Theme: The Art of Becoming.
A reminder that every person, every project, every community is in motion. The 2026 edition focuses on participation. Sessions invite people to take part, not only observe. Bring learnings from your regional burn. Test a new idea. Try something playful or unexpected. New voices are welcome, including groups that have not presented before.

What you can submit

  • Interactive sessions from 30 to 75 minutes

  • Play and connection experiences

  • Evening magic: performances, themed settings, cultural exchanges, games

  • Installation art shaping the space

  • Anything that brings your perspective and energy

  • New for 2026: Deep Dive Working Sessions for intensive co-creation on community topics, chosen during event registration

Key date

  • 15 January 2026: deadline for proposals

Based on the Burning Man principles.

You are self-reliant!
At the 50/50 Fest, there’s nothing for sale. You are responsible for bringing everything you’ll need for the weekend.

Leave no trace!
Make sure there is no trace of us. There are no trash bins, so you’ll need to take all your waste home. Really? Really
